habotnic
Romanian edit
Etymology edit
Borrowed from Russian хабадник (xabadnik, “Chabadnik”), from Хабад (Xabad, “Chabad”), from Hebrew חב״ד (“Chabad”), acronym of חוכמה / חָכְמָה (khokhmá, “wisdom”), בִּינָה (biná, “understanding”), דַּעַת (dá'at, “knowledge”).
Noun edit
habotnic m (plural habotnici)
- bigoted person
